add numbers to an array correspondingly

A= [ 6 10 14 ]
B= 0.0152 0.0134 0.0120
0.0121 0.0109 0.0100
0.0089 0.0084 0.0079
0.0058 0.0058 0.0058
answer= 6.0152 10.0134 14.0120
6.0121 10.0109 14.0100
6.0089 10.0084 14.0079
6.0058 10.0058 14.0058
i want to add first column from A with the first column from B and so on

Use bsxfun:
A = [ 6 10 14 ];
B = [0.0152 0.0134 0.0120
0.0121 0.0109 0.0100
0.0089 0.0084 0.0079
0.0058 0.0058 0.0058];
answer = bsxfun(@plus, A, B)
producing:
answer =
6.0152 10.0134 14.0120
6.0121 10.0109 14.0100
6.0089 10.0084 14.0079
6.0058 10.0058 14.0058

If you have a fairly recent version of MATLAB, that does automatic expansion, you can simply do
output = B + A
